perf report: Add --switch-on/--switch-off events
Since 'perf top' shares the histogram browser with 'perf report', then
the same explanation in the previous cset applies.
An additional example uses a pair of SDT events available for systemtap:

And now only what happens in slices demarcated by those start/end SDT
events:
[root@quaco testsuite]# perf report --switch-on=sdt_stap:pass2__start --switch-off=sdt_stap:pass2__end | grep cycles:P -A100

441 | --switch-on EVENT_NAME:: | ||
442 | Only consider events after this event is found. | ||
443 | |||
444 | This may be interesting to measure a workload only after some initialization | ||
445 | phase is over, i.e. insert a perf probe at that point and then using this | ||
446 | option with that probe. | ||
447 | |||
448 | --switch-off EVENT_NAME:: | ||
449 | Stop considering events after this event is found. | ||
450 | |||
451 | --show-on-off-events:: | ||
452 | Show the --switch-on/off events too. This has no effect in 'perf report' now | ||
453 | but probably we'll make the default not to show the switch-on/off events | ||
454 | on the --group mode and if there is only one event besides the off/on ones, | ||
455 | go straight to the histogram browser, just like 'perf report' with no events | ||
456 | explicitely specified does. | ||
